WebSep 20, 2024 · To calculate how much a solar panel produces per day, simply multiply the solar panel output by the peak sun hours: 400W x 4.5 hours = 1,800 Watt-hours per day To convert to the standard measurement of kWh, simply divide by 1,000 to find that one 400W panel can produce 1.8 kWh per day. WebAs Electrons pass through the cells of a solar panel, they're converted into direct current (DC) electricity. Inverter That electricity is sent to an inverter which converts it into alternating current (AC) power. Home Appliances That AC power runs through your home ready to power appliances charge devices and more.
